Admissions Counselor/Recruiter


Savannah Technical College


Location

Savannah, GA | United States


Job description

Savannah Technical College is seeking a full-time Admissions Counselor/Recruiter. Under general supervision, plans and implements student recruitment activities, assists prospective students with the admission and readmission process, processes new student applications, and may coordinate the Post-Secondary Options Program and dual enrollment with high schools. Completes administrative reports, provides information to prospective and enrolled students concerning financial aid assistance, vocational opportunities, program choice/change, educational requisites, and policy/procedures. May also provide job placement services to students, administer various testing programs and perform evening Administrator duties. Job duties may include, but are not limited to the following:

Physical Demands
The employee occasionally lifts or moves objects of a light to medium weight. Work is typically performed in an office environment with intermittent sitting, standing, or walking in various settings. The employee must be able to lift up to 25 pounds. Full range of hand and finger motion may be utilized for data entry purposes.



Salary/Benefits
Salary is commensurate with education and work experience . Benefits include paid state holidays, annual and sick leave, and the State of Georgia Flexible Benefits package. Positions are contingent upon funding.
